Christopher was born in Defiance, Ohio and currently lives in Paulding. Growing up, Christopher spent time living in Ohio, Kentucky, and Tennessee. He graduated Paulding High School in 2017 and initially started at Bowling Green State University studying to teach Spanish; he is currently pursuing his Bachelor’s in Social Work from Mount Vernon Nazarene University.

You may have met Christopher when he designed kitchens at Menards for nearly three years, spending most of his career at the Defiance location before becoming an assistant department manager in Fort Wayne. After leaving Menards, Christopher worked in IT and event marketing before finding his home at the Marsh Foundation in Van Wert.

Christopher has worked for the Marsh Foundation since early 2023 as a Family Teacher. He earned the Lead title in 2025, as well as being voted the Marsh Foundation’s first ever Practitioner of the Year by his peers. Christopher helps youth and their families by teaching kids how to overcome their behavioral challenges and navigate their life experiences. In addition to working directly with the youth in a residential setting, Christopher serves at the Marsh by participating in the interview and training process and assisting in an on-call rotation.

Christopher volunteers with PC Workshop, a work-ready program based in Paulding for adults with developmental disabilities. He is also a former volunteer for Youth for Christ and Lifewise.

Christopher became a foster kid in high school and is thankful for his foster family and his community. It was this experience that formed the foundation for his work with kids and mental/behavioral health, and it is through his work in this field that led to his campaign for State Representative.
